We have an excellent opportunity for Client Support Administrators to join our Glasgow office.


The Client Support team are responsible for the quality and timely delivery of high level administrative support for Financial Planners and Paraplanners to ensure a great client experience and service.


Key Outputs:

  • Working with the Client Support Team Leader to ensure all Client Support activities adhere to policies and meet agreed standards and timescales in terms of quality and time.
  • Ensure any business obtained is being processed and submitted compliantly and in a timely manner within defined business processes.
  • Prioritise and plan own workload and be proactive.
  • Identify areas for improvement to maximise efficiency and effectively maintain an excellent client experience.
  • Working collaboratively and proactively across the team to support and assist colleagues, maintaining effective relationships.

Problem Solving:

  • Effective management and ability to maintain excellent client service and delivery while meeting simultaneous demands.
  • Embrace change and support Client Support Team Leader in implementing change.
  • Responding flexibly, quickly and effectively to constantly shifting priorities within a highly pressured environment
  • Maintain effective relationships with colleagues, clients and third parties.
  • Being rigorously planned and organised to ensure demanding targets are achieved.

What we're looking for:

  • Proven administrative experience within a wealth management or financial planning business
  • An ability to prioritise work effectively, work under pressure and to strict deadlines.
  • Work to a consistently high professional standard and level of accuracy.
  • Strong planning and organisational skills to ensure activities are aligned to business priorities.
  • Proven ability to work collaboratively in a fast paced team to ensure the smooth running the team and company as a whole.
  • Excellent knowledge and experience of Intelligent Office and MS Office Products.
  • SVQ In Business Administration (preferred)
